std::from_range, std::from_range_t
From cppreference.com
Defined in header <ranges>
|
||
struct from_range_t { explicit from_range_t() = default; }; |
(since C++23) | |
inline constexpr std::from_range_t from_range {}; |
(since C++23) | |
std::from_range
is a disambiguation tag that can be passed to the constructors of the suitable containers to indicate that the contained member is range constructed.
The corresponding type std::from_range_t
can be used in the constructor's parameter list to match the intended tag.
